    9. Mortgage Reports, continued
      • Tax Roll Description
          • Not an accurate legal description
          • Usually changed and abbreviated by clerical staff and assessors to shorten record files

    15. Mortgage Reports, continued
      • Important fact:
          • Property lines are not accurately established or set as a part of the report unless asked for at time of request
      Gould Engineering, Inc. Civil Engineering | Land Surveying | Land Planning… Since 1916
    16. Mortgage Reports, continued
      • Issues surveyors encounter:
          • Lack of accurate legal description furnished
          • Legal description provided does not include total land occupied by residence or business
          • No title work provided with Schedule “B” exceptions
      Gould Engineering, Inc. Civil Engineering | Land Surveying | Land Planning… Since 1916

    18. Floodplain Surveys
      • What is a floodplain?
          • Those areas that are commonly inundated by flooding
      • What is a 100-year flood?
          • A flood event that has a 1% chance of occurring in any given year
      Gould Engineering, Inc. Civil Engineering | Land Surveying | Land Planning… Since 1916
    19. Floodplain Surveys, continued
      • What is a flood risk?
        • During a 30 year mortgage of a home in a SFHA, there is a 26% chance it will flood
        • During a 50 year period the chances increase to 39%
      Gould Engineering, Inc. Civil Engineering | Land Surveying | Land Planning… Since 1916
    20. Floodplain Surveys, continued
      • Floodplain Zones
          • Zone A
          • A1 - A30
          • Zone B
          • Zone C
      Gould Engineering, Inc. Civil Engineering | Land Surveying | Land Planning… Since 1916
    21. Floodplain Surveys, continued
      • Zone A
          • Areas of 100-year flood (estimated)
          • Base flood elevations and flood hazard factors are not determined
          • Surveyor will need to contact MDEQ to obtain floodplain elevation for the site.
      Gould Engineering, Inc. Civil Engineering | Land Surveying | Land Planning… Since 1916
    22. Floodplain Surveys, continued
      • Zones A1 - A30
          • Areas of 100-year flood
          • Base flood elevations and flood hazard factors are determined
      Gould Engineering, Inc. Civil Engineering | Land Surveying | Land Planning… Since 1916
    23. Floodplain Surveys, continued
      • Zone B
          • Areas of 500-year flood
      • Zone C
          • Areas of minimal flooding
      Gould Engineering, Inc. Civil Engineering | Land Surveying | Land Planning… Since 1916

    27. Floodplain Surveys, continued
      • Regulating Agencies for the National Flood Insurance Program
          • FEMA - Federal Emergency Management Agency
          • MDEQ - Michigan Department of Environmental Quality (land and water management division)
          • County - Local county drain commissioner’s office (storm water management division)
      Gould Engineering, Inc. Civil Engineering | Land Surveying | Land Planning… Since 1916
    28. Floodplain Surveys, continued
      • Who can establish floodplain elevations?
          • FEMA
          • MDEQ
          • Local drain commissioner
      Gould Engineering, Inc. Civil Engineering | Land Surveying | Land Planning… Since 1916
    29. Floodplain Surveys, continued
      • How can homeowners get relief from flood insurance?
          • Have a professional land surveyor:
              • Complete an elevation certificate
              • Prepare a Letter of Map Amendment (LOMA)
      Gould Engineering, Inc. Civil Engineering | Land Surveying | Land Planning… Since 1916
